Stepping into the newly refurbished Youth Resource Center in Agonga, Gulu City, I was immediately struck by the quiet resolve within its walls. There sat a young man, head bowed, entirely absorbed in his studies. Witnessing this filled me with immense joy, affirming that this dedicated space was fulfilling its purpose: to serve young people like him—those out of school or lacking a conducive learning environment at home.

This center, originally a Youth ART clinic hub, has undergone a vital transformation. Adapting to recent funding shifts, we have repurposed it into a vibrant reading room and a safe haven. Here, young people can not only pursue their education but also access crucial HIV/AIDS counseling and a range of other beneficial resources.

I had the opportunity to speak with Charles, a Senior Three student diligently preparing for his exams. He shared how invaluable this quiet space is for his studies, expressing a strong ambition to excel. This is precisely the kind of profound impact we strive for in our community. Many homes in the area lack adequate lighting, schools often contend with insufficient reading materials, and parents may struggle to provide the comprehensive support their children need to thrive academically. The center directly addresses these systemic barriers.
